Summary
This study examines painful legs and moving toes syndrome, a neurological disorder. Four patients had peripheral nervous system issues, while one had a central nervous system lesion, with findings compared to existing literature.

Background:
- Painful legs and moving toes syndrome (PLMT) is a rare neurological disorder characterized by distressing leg pain and involuntary toe movements.
- The syndrome, as defined by Spillane et al. (1971), presents diagnostic challenges due to its varied etiology.
- Understanding the underlying pathophysiology is crucial for effective management.
Observation:
- Five patients diagnosed with painful legs and moving toes syndrome were evaluated.
- Four patients exhibited symptoms indicative of a peripheral nervous system disorder.
- One patient presented with clinical evidence pointing to a central nervous system lesion.
Findings:
- Clinical and electrophysiologic investigations were performed on the four patients with peripheral nervous system involvement.
- Results from these investigations were systematically compared with existing literature data on PLMT.
- The findings highlight potential differences and similarities in clinical presentation and electrophysiologic markers between peripheral and central subtypes.
Implications:
- The study contributes to a better understanding of the heterogeneous nature of painful legs and moving toes syndrome.
- Differentiating between peripheral and central nervous system involvement is critical for targeted treatment strategies.
- Further research is warranted to elucidate the specific mechanisms driving PLMT in different patient groups.
